Home Data Entry How to Create an Effective Data Entry Form in Excel: A Complete...

How to Create an Effective Data Entry Form in Excel: A Complete Guide

296
0
Data Entry Form in Excel

Tired of messy spreadsheets and constant typing errors? Discover how a well-designed Data Entry Form in Excel can revolutionize your workflow, ensuring accuracy and saving you countless hours.

This comprehensive guide walks you through building a Data Entry Form in Excel from scratch. We cover everything from setting up your table structure and using the hidden “Form” tool to designing advanced custom interfaces with VBA macros. You will learn best practices for validation, automation, and data integrity to master your spreadsheet management.

Why Create Data Entry Forms in Excel?

In the world of data management, accuracy and efficiency are paramount. While many businesses rush to buy expensive software, they often overlook a powerful tool already at their fingertips. Creating a Data Entry Form in Excel is a strategic move that offers flexibility without the high price tag of specialized CRM or ERP systems.

When you rely on standard spreadsheet entry—clicking cell by cell across a row—human error is almost inevitable. A user might accidentally type a phone number in the “Date” column or overwrite a critical formula. A dedicated Data Entry Form in Excel acts as a protective layer between the user and the raw data.

The Core Benefits

  • Reduced Errors: By using features like Data Validation, you ensure that only specific types of data (like dates or numbers) enter your system.
  • Speed: Pressing “Tab” to move through a form is significantly faster than navigating a massive grid.
  • Data Integrity: Forms prevent users from accidentally deleting rows or breaking formulas in the backend database.
  • Cost-Effectiveness: Why pay for a subscription service when you can create a data entry form in Excel for free using software you already own?

Whether you are looking to automate manual data entry or simply organize a client list, Excel provides a robust platform to build a solution tailored to your exact needs.

Setting Up Your Excel Worksheet

Setting Up Your Excel Worksheet

Before you can build the interface, you must lay a solid foundation. Think of your worksheet as the database where all the information collected by your Data Entry Form in Excel will live.

Step 1: Define Your Table Structure

The first step is planning. What specific data points do you need? Avoid the temptation to collect everything; focus on actionable data. Open a blank Excel sheet and create headers in the first row.

Common headers might include:

  • ID Number
  • First Name
  • Last Name
  • Department
  • Start Date
  • Salary

Pro Tip: Avoid merging cells in your header row. Merged cells often cause issues when you try to apply Robotic Process Automation for Data Entry or other advanced scripts later on.

Step 2: Format as an Official Excel Table

This is a critical step that many beginners skip. Highlighting your headers and data area and pressing Ctrl + T converts the range into an official Excel Table.

Why is this important for a Data Entry Form in Excel?

  1. Dynamic Expansion: As you add new records, the table automatically expands to include them.
  2. Readable Formulas: Formulas will use column names (e.g., [@Salary]) instead of abstract cell references like C2.
  3. Aesthetics: It instantly applies readable formatting.

Once your table is set up, name it something recognizable, like EmployeeData, in the Table Design tab. This makes referencing it in Excel macros for data entry automation much easier later.

Creating the Data Entry Form

Creating the Data Entry Form

There are two primary ways to approach this: using the built-in tool or designing a custom interface.

Option A: The Built-in Data Entry Form (No Coding Required)

Did you know Excel has a hidden feature specifically for this? It allows you to generate a simple Data Entry Form in Excel in seconds.

How to Enable the Form Tool:

  1. Go to the Quick Access Toolbar (top left).
  2. Click the dropdown and select “More Commands.”
  3. Change “Popular Commands” to “All Commands.”
  4. Scroll down to find “Form…” and click “Add.”

Using the Tool:
Click anywhere inside your official Excel table and click the new “Form” button you just added. A dialog box will appear automatically generating fields based on your column headers. You can add “New,” “Delete,” or “Find” records immediately.

This method is perfect for those who ask, “How to create a data entry form in Excel quickly?” without needing to design a layout.

Option B: Designing a Custom Data Entry Layout (User-Centric)

For a professional look, you should build a custom interface on a separate sheet. This allows you to arrange fields logically, add your company logo, and include instructional text.

  1. Create a “Form” Sheet: Rename a new sheet to “Data Entry.”
  2. Design the Interface: Use cell borders and background colors to create input fields. Leave space between fields for a clean look.
  3. Label Clearly: Place text labels (e.g., “Employee Name”) next to the empty cells where users will type.
  4. Format Input Cells: If a cell requires a date, format it as a Date in Excel properties. If it requires currency, format it as Currency.

This custom approach prepares you for How to Automate Data Entry in Excel using macros, which we will cover in the advanced section.

Advanced Features: Supercharging Your Form

Advanced Features Supercharging Your Form

To truly make your Data Entry Form in Excel effective, you need to move beyond basic text boxes. You want a smart form that guides the user and prevents mistakes.

1. Data Validation and Drop-Down Lists

One of the Best Practices for Web Form Data Entry applies here too: restrict user input. If a user needs to select a Department, don’t let them type “HR,” “Human Resources,” and “H.R.” differently.

  • Select the cell where the department goes.
  • Go to the Data tab > Data Validation.
  • Choose “List” and type your options: Sales, Marketing, HR, IT.

Now, your Data Entry Form in Excel has a dropdown menu, ensuring consistency for future data analysis.

2. Conditional Formatting for Visual Cues

You can use Conditional Formatting to alert users if they miss a field.

  • Select your input cells.
  • Create a New Rule: =ISBLANK(A1).
  • Set the format to fill the cell with a light red color.

Now, if a required field is empty, it glows red, prompting the user to complete the Data Entry Form in Excel before trying to save.

3. Using Macros for Automation

This is where you transition from a static sheet to an app-like experience. You can record a macro that takes the data from your “Form” sheet and pastes it into your “Database” sheet automatically.

How to Automate Data Entry in Excel with a Macro:

  1. Enable Developer Tab: Right-click the ribbon > Customize Ribbon > Check “Developer”.
  2. Start Recording: Click “Record Macro.”
  3. Copy Data: Copy the input cells from your Form sheet.
  4. Paste Transposed: Go to your Database sheet, find the next empty row, and use “Paste Special > Transpose” (to turn vertical form data into a horizontal row).
  5. Clear Form: Go back to the Form sheet and delete the data in the input cells so it’s ready for the next entry.
  6. Stop Recording.

Assign this macro to a button shape. Now, users fill out the Data Entry Form in Excel, click “Save,” and the computer does the rest. This is a basic form of Programmable Automation Work.

Best Practices for Designing Data Entry Forms

When learning How to Create an Effective Data Entry Form, design philosophy is just as important as technical skill. A confusing form leads to bad data.

Keep It Logical

Group related fields together. For example, personal information (Name, ID) should be separate from contact details (Email, Phone). This mirrors how we think and reduces cognitive load, a concept often discussed in Easy Cybersecurity or Artificial Intelligence user interface design.

Minimize Keystrokes

The goal of a Data Entry Form in Excel is speed.

  • Use “Tab Order” settings in VBA forms to ensure the cursor jumps to the correct next field.
  • Set defaults for common values (e.g., set the “Country” field to “USA” automatically if 90% of your clients are domestic).

Protect Your Structure

You must use sheet protection. Unlock only the input cells, then protect the worksheet. This prevents users from accidentally deleting your labels or your “Save” button. This security is vital, similar to basic E-commerce Data Security Practices.

Test Before Deployment

Before sharing your Data Entry Form in Excel, try to break it. Enter text in number fields. Leave fields blank. This “stress testing” ensures your Data Entry Systems are robust enough for daily use.

Taking Your Data Entry Form to the Next Level

Taking Your Data Entry Form to the Next Level

Once you have mastered the basics, where do you go from here? The landscape of data management is evolving toward Robotic Process Automation for Data Entry and AI integration.

VBA and UserForms

For a fully professional look that pops up in a separate window (like a software dialog box), you can use VBA UserForms. This requires coding knowledge but offers granular control over every aspect of the Data Entry Form in Excel.

Integration with Power Automate

If you are using Office 365, you can link your Excel data to Microsoft Power Automate. Imagine filling out your Data Entry Form in Excel, and having it automatically send an email confirmation or update a SharePoint list. This bridges the gap between desktop Excel and Cloud-Based Data Management in E-commerce.

OCR and AI

The future is Automated Data Entry AI. New tools allow you to take a picture of a receipt or invoice, and using Revolutionize Data Entry with OCR and AI, the data is extracted and dumped directly into your Excel sheet. This eliminates typing entirely for certain tasks. Learning How to Automate Manual Data Entry using these tools puts you ahead of the curve.

Conclusion

Creating a custom Data Entry Form in Excel is more than just a technical exercise; it is a business process improvement that pays immediate dividends. By structuring your data, enforcing validation, and automating the saving process, you transform Excel from a simple calculator into a powerful data management engine.

Whether you are a small business owner tracking inventory or a data analyst streamlining workflows, the ability to build a robust Data Entry Form in Excel is an essential skill. Start with the built-in tools, experiment with macros, and eventually, you will find yourself mastering Excel Data Entry Automation.

Take control of your data today. Build your form, secure your inputs, and watch your efficiency soar.

FAQs

1. What is the fastest way to create a Data Entry Form in Excel?

The fastest method is using the built-in “Form” tool. You simply create a table with headers, add the “Form” command to your Quick Access Toolbar, and click it. This generates a basic Data Entry Form in Excel instantly without any design work or coding.

2. Can I create a Data Entry Form in Excel without using macros?

Yes, absolutely. You can use the built-in Form tool mentioned above. However, if you want a custom layout with specific colors and button placements on a sheet, you will generally need simple macros to automate the “Save” and “Clear” actions.

3. How do I add a drop-down list to my Data Entry Form in Excel?

You use Data Validation. Select the cell, go to the Data tab, click Data Validation, select “List” from the Allow options, and either type your options separated by commas or reference a list of cells elsewhere in your workbook.

4. Is it possible to automate data entry from PDF to Excel?

Yes. Modern versions of Excel (via the “Get Data” tab) and external tools utilize Revolutionize Data Entry with OCR and AI technologies. These tools scan PDF documents, recognize the text structures, and import them into Excel, significantly reducing manual typing.

5. How does a Data Entry Form in Excel improve data accuracy?

It restricts what users can input. By using Data Validation rules (like forcing dates to be in a certain year or numbers to be positive), the Data Entry Form in Excel rejects invalid entries immediately, preventing “dirty data” from entering your database.

6. Can I use a Data Entry Form in Excel on a mobile device?

Standard Excel macros and VBA UserForms do not work on the Excel Mobile app. However, if you use the Excel table structure, the mobile app has a “Cards View” that functions similarly to a basic Data Entry Form in Excel, allowing for easy mobile input.

7. What is the difference between a Worksheet Form and a VBA UserForm?

A Worksheet Form is built directly on the grid of the spreadsheet using cells and buttons. A VBA UserForm is a separate, floating dialog window programmed using Visual Basic. UserForms look more like professional software but require more coding skill to create.

8. Can I connect my Data Entry Form in Excel to a website?

Directly, no. However, you can use tools like Microsoft Power Automate or Python Data Entry Automation scripts to bridge the gap. You can set up workflows where data entered in a web form (like Google Forms) is automatically pushed into your Excel sheet.

9. How do I protect my Data Entry Form so users don’t break it?

You should use the “Protect Sheet” feature under the Review tab. Before protecting the sheet, ensure you “Unlock” the specific cells where users need to type. This ensures the structure of your Data Entry Form in Excel remains intact while allowing data input.

10. Will data entry jobs be automated by Excel and AI?

While Robotic Process Automation for Data Entry handles repetitive tasks, human oversight is still required for complex decision-making and interpreting unstructured data. Learning to build these forms makes you the manager of the automation, rather than the one being replaced by it.

LEAVE A REPLY

Please enter your comment!
Please enter your name here